About #AB76B3 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 292°, a saturation of 29%, and a lightness of 58%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 292°, a saturation of 34%, and a value of 70%.
- HEX: #AB76B3
- RGB: rgb(171, 118, 179)
- HSL: hsl(292, 29%, 58%)
- HSV: hsv(292, 34%, 70%)
- CMYK: 4.00% cyan, 34.00% magenta, 0.00% yellow, 30.00% black
- XYZ: 31.18, 24.78, 34.52
- Yxy: 24.78, 0.3446, 0.2739
- Hunter Lab: 56.86, 29.15, -23.95
- CIE-Lab: 56.86, 29.15, -23.95
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 31.18, Y: 24.78, Z: 34.52.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 24.78, x: 0.3446, and y: 0.2739.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 56.86, a: 29.15, and b: -23.95.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 56.86, a: 29.15, and b: -23.95.
